Papua New Guinea weather overview
Papua New Guinea, the eastern part of the island of New Guinea, has mountains at its heart and a tropical climate throughout. The swamplands in the south (which include Port Moresby) have the lowest rainfall but are always humid and oppressive. Higher regions are cooler, with snow on the highest peaks and heavy rainfall all year. The north, which includes the Sepik River, endures torrential rains during the northwest monsoon (November to March).
What to pack for Papua New Guinea weather
Take light clothing and add heavier clothes and rainwear if you are going to the highlands.
Which is the hottest month in Papua New Guinea?
The hottest time of year in Port Moresby, Papua New Guinea is normally December. Expect maximum daytime temperatures to reach 31°C with very high heat and humidity.
Which month has the most rain in Papua New Guinea?
In terms of rainfall, March is usually the wettest month in Port Moresby, Papua New Guinea with 248mm on average. There are normally 19 days in March with some rain.
When is it sunniest in Papua New Guinea?
The sunniest time of year in Port Moresby, Papua New Guinea is normally October with bright sunshine on average for 58% of daylight hours; that's 7 hours of sunshine per day.
When is the sea warmest in Papua New Guinea?
The sea is usually at its warmest in Port Moresby, Papua New Guinea in January when the water temperature reaches 29°C.
What is the time difference between Papua New Guinea and the UK?
The time difference between Papua New Guinea and the UK is GMT+10 to GMT+11 hours.
What is the main language spoken in Papua New Guinea?
The main languages spoken in Papua New Guinea are Tok Pisin and English.

What is the currency in Papua New Guinea?
The currency in Papua New Guinea is the Papua New Guinean Kina (PGK).

Which plugs are used in Papua New Guinea?
Papua New Guinea uses electrical plug type I (240 Volts).
Which side of the road do they drive on in Papua New Guinea?
They drive on the left side of the road in Papua New Guinea.
